Analysis

In 2025, employment to population ratio, 15+, female (%) in Kyrgyzstan stood at 42.4%.

The figure is down 0.1% on the previous year and down 6.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, employment to population ratio, 15+, female (%) in Kyrgyzstan peaked at 61.5% in 1995 and was at its lowest, 40.4%, in 2017.

Kyrgyzstan ranks 132nd of 187 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 35 years of available data.

Employment to population ratio, 15+, female (%) in Kyrgyzstan, year by year

Annual values for Employment to population ratio, 15+, female (%) (modeled ILO estimate) in Kyrgyzstan, 1991 to 2025.
Year Value Change
1991 49.0%
1992 51.9% +5.9%
1993 55.2% +6.4%
1994 60.1% +8.8%
1995 61.5% +2.4%
1996 60.2% -2.2%
1997 58.3% -3.1%
1998 58.1% -0.4%
1999 57.5% -1.0%
2000 56.5% -1.7%
2001 55.5% -1.8%
2002 55.6% +0.2%
2003 54.3% -2.4%
2004 53.0% -2.3%
2005 53.2% +0.3%
2006 52.7% -1.0%
2007 51.1% -3.0%
2008 49.6% -2.9%
2009 49.2% -0.8%
2010 49.5% +0.5%
2011 50.0% +1.2%
2012 48.0% -4.2%
2013 43.9% -8.5%
2014 45.5% +3.7%
2015 45.3% -0.4%
2016 44.0% -2.9%
2017 40.4% -8.2%
2018 41.8% +3.6%
2019 41.3% -1.3%
2020 40.8% -1.1%
2021 41.3% +1.2%
2022 42.5% +2.9%
2023 41.7% -2.0%
2024 42.4% +1.8%
2025 42.4% -0.1%
